Police corporal pleads not guilty to rape charge

A police corporal pleaded not guilty in the Sessions Court here today to a rape charge.
Sophiaan Sahrun, 34, who is with the Wangsa Maju district police headquarters, was charged with raping a self-employed 29-year-old woman in a room at a hotel in Jalan Pudu here between 2 am and 6 am last Aug 28.
The charge, under Section 376 of the Penal Code, provides an imprisonment for up to 20 years and is liable to whipping, if found guilty.
Deputy public prosecutor Liyana Zawani Mohd Radzi, who prosecuted, did not offer bail, but lawyer Fahmi Adilah, representing Sophiaan, requested his client to be allowed bail as he is married and has a family to support.
Judge Datin M. Kunasundary then allowed Sophiaan bail at RM10,000 in one surety and also warned him against intimidating the victim.
The court set Jan 16 for mention. - Bernama
